Skip to content

Two test failures when VS2017 installed #718

@dsyme

Description

@dsyme

Two test failures on Windows when VS2017 RC installed

Repro steps

.\build All.NetFx

Expected behavior

Tests pass

Actual behavior

Tests fail

Related information

Tests run: 213, Errors: 2, Failures: 0, Inconclusive: 0, Time: 87.8881411043107 seconds
  Not run: 4, Invalid: 0, Ignored: 4, Skipped: 0

Errors and Failures:
1) Test Error : FSharp.Compiler.Service.Tests.ExprTests.Check use of type provider that provides calls to F# code
   System.Runtime.Serialization.SerializationException : Expecting element 'root' from namespace ''.. Encountered 'None'  with name '', namespace ''.
   at System.Runtime.Serialization.Json.DataContractJsonSerializer.InternalReadObject(XmlReaderDelegator xmlReader, Boolean verifyObjectName)
   at System.Runtime.Serialization.XmlObjectSerializer.ReadObjectHandleExceptions(XmlReaderDelegator reader, Boolean verifyObjectName, DataContractResolver dataContractResolver)
   at System.Runtime.Serialization.Json.DataContractJsonSerializer.ReadObject(XmlDictionaryReader reader)
   at Microsoft.FSharp.Compiler.SourceCodeServices.ProjectCracker.GetProjectOptionsFromProjectFileLogged(String projectFileName, FSharpOption`1 properties, FSharpOption`1 loadedTimeStamp, FSharpOption`1 enableLogging) in C:\GitHub\dsyme\FSharp.Compiler.Service\src\fsharp\FSharp.Compiler.Service.ProjectCracker\ProjectCracker.fs:line 75
   at Microsoft.FSharp.Compiler.SourceCodeServices.ProjectCracker.GetProjectOptionsFromProjectFile(String projectFileName, FSharpOption`1 properties, FSharpOption`1 loadedTimeStamp) in C:\GitHub\dsyme\FSharp.Compiler.Service\src\fsharp\FSharp.Compiler.Service.ProjectCracker\ProjectCracker.fs:line 82
   at FSharp.Compiler.Service.Tests.ExprTests.Check use of type provider that provides calls to F# code() in C:\GitHub\dsyme\FSharp.Compiler.Service\tests\service\ExprTests.fs:line 868

2) Test Error : FSharp.Compiler.Service.Tests.ProjectOptionsTests.Project file parsing example 1 Release Configuration
   System.Runtime.Serialization.SerializationException : Expecting element 'root' from namespace ''.. Encountered 'None'  with name '', namespace ''.
   at System.Runtime.Serialization.Json.DataContractJsonSerializer.InternalReadObject(XmlReaderDelegator xmlReader, Boolean verifyObjectName)
   at System.Runtime.Serialization.XmlObjectSerializer.ReadObjectHandleExceptions(XmlReaderDelegator reader, Boolean verifyObjectName, DataContractResolver dataContractResolver)
   at System.Runtime.Serialization.Json.DataContractJsonSerializer.ReadObject(XmlDictionaryReader reader)
   at Microsoft.FSharp.Compiler.SourceCodeServices.ProjectCracker.GetProjectOptionsFromProjectFileLogged(String projectFileName, FSharpOption`1 properties, FSharpOption`1 loadedTimeStamp, FSharpOption`1 enableLogging) in C:\GitHub\dsyme\FSharp.Compiler.Service\src\fsharp\FSharp.Compiler.Service.ProjectCracker\ProjectCracker.fs:line 75
   at Microsoft.FSharp.Compiler.SourceCodeServices.ProjectCracker.GetProjectOptionsFromProjectFile(String projectFileName, FSharpOption`1 properties, FSharpOption`1 loadedTimeStamp) in C:\GitHub\dsyme\FSharp.Compiler.Service\src\fsharp\FSharp.Compiler.Service.ProjectCracker\ProjectCracker.fs:line 82
   at FSharp.Compiler.Service.Tests.ProjectOptionsTests.Project file parsing example 1 Release Configuration() in C:\GitHub\dsyme\FSharp.Compiler.Service\tests\service\ProjectOptionsTests.fs:line 66


Tests Not Run:
1) Ignored : FSharp.Compiler.Service.Tests.FsiTests.EvalExpression function value 4
   Failing test for #135
2) Ignored : Tests.Service.Editor.Find function from member 1
   Currently failing, see #139
3) Ignored : Tests.Service.Editor.Symbol based find function from member 1
   Currently failing, see #139
4) Ignored : Tests.Service.ProjectAnalysisTests.Test project1 should not throw exceptions on entities from referenced assemblies
   FCS should not throw exceptions on FSharpEntity.BaseType

Metadata

Metadata

Assignees

No one assigned

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ions